Eligibility Criteria & Qualifications

All applicants must possess a Ph.D. in a relevant or equivalent discipline with First Class marks in preceding degrees from the Bachelor’s level onwards.

  • Assistant Professor Grade II (Level 10): Requires a Ph.D. with no mandatory post-doctoral experience.
  • Assistant Professor Grade I (Level 12): Requires a Ph.D. with a minimum of 3 years of post-Ph.D. experience OR 6 years of total teaching/research/industrial experience. Candidates must have at least 20 cumulative credit points.
  • Associate Professor (Level 13A2): Requires a Ph.D. with a minimum of 6 years of post-Ph.D. experience (with at least 3 years at Level 12) OR 9 years of total experience. A minimum of 50 cumulative credit points is essential.

Selection Process

The selection follows the 4-Tier Flexible Faculty Structure approved by the Ministry of Education.

  • Credit Point Screening: Initial shortlisting based on research publications, projects, and academic credits.
  • Written Test: May be conducted for specific grades (e.g., Grade II) if the number of applicants is high.
  • Presentation & Interview: Shortlisted candidates must present their research work before the Selection Committee for final evaluation.
